> My Date is locked on 12/31/1969 - 7:55pm.
> I cant find any folder to adjust date.
>
>
> I have set my time zone to America/Detroit - & 12 hour time setting.
> My IP address shows & am able to stream from network.
>
> Any suggestions....?

I assume you have a shell? The 'date' command should allow you to set
the date. That said, it's my understanding the Pi doesn't have an RTC,
so you'll lose the date across reboots.

What you really want is ntpd installed and running.
